Deconstructing the Toolkit: A Tale of Two Components
When we talk about Glutathione needles syringes, we're actually discussing two separate but interconnected pieces of equipment. Understanding each one's function is the first step toward making an informed choice.
First, the syringe. This is the calibrated barrel with the plunger that holds and dispenses the liquid. The key features to consider are:
- Volume: Measured in milliliters (mL) or cubic centimeters (cc), which are interchangeable. For peptide research, you'll almost always be using small-volume syringes, typically 1mL, 0.5mL, or 0.3mL. Using a massive 10mL syringe for a 0.2mL dose is asking for trouble.
- Markings: This is critical. Insulin syringes, marked in "Units," are the gold standard for many peptide protocols. A U-100 syringe holds 1mL, and its 100 distinct markings allow for incredibly precise measurements. Tuberculin syringes, marked in mL, are another excellent option.
- Tip Type: Luer-Lok tips have a threaded screw mechanism to securely attach a needle, while Luer-Slip tips use a friction fit. For research applications, both are effective, but Luer-Lok provides that extra bit of security against accidental detachment.
Next, the needle. It's not just a sharp piece of metal. Its characteristics directly impact the administration process.
- Gauge (G): This refers to the needle's thickness or diameter. Here’s the counterintuitive part: the higher the gauge number, the thinner the needle. A 31G needle is much finer than a 25G needle. For subcutaneous injections common with Glutathione, researchers typically use very fine needles (29G to 31G) to minimize subject discomfort.
- Length: Measured in inches, common lengths for subcutaneous injections are short, such as 1/2" (12.7mm) or 5/16" (8mm). This ensures the peptide is delivered into the fatty tissue layer, not the muscle below. The choice of Glutathione needles syringes must account for both of these needle properties for optimal delivery.
Choosing Your Glutathione Needles Syringes: A Practical Framework
Okay, let's move from theory to application. You have your vial of lyophilized Glutathione and your bacteriostatic water. How do you select the ideal Glutathione needles syringes for the job? It comes down to matching the tool to the specific requirements of your protocol.
For subcutaneous administration of Glutathione, which is the most common route in research settings, our team almost universally recommends an insulin syringe. Here's why: their fine-gauge, fixed needles and precise unit markings are perfectly suited for the small, accurate doses required in peptide research. A 0.5mL, 30G, 1/2" insulin syringe is a workhorse in our field.
But what if your protocol requires you to draw from a vial with a thick rubber stopper multiple times? Pushing a fine 30G needle through that stopper repeatedly can dull the tip. In these cases, a syringe with a detachable Luer-Lok needle might be better. You can use a thicker, more robust needle (like a 25G) for drawing the solution, then swap it for a fine 31G needle for administration. This preserves the sharpness of the injection needle. This two-needle technique is a professional standard for maintaining sterility and ensuring a smooth injection. The flexibility in your choice of Glutathione needles syringes allows for these nuanced approaches.

The Step-by-Step Protocol: Handling Glutathione Needles Syringes with Precision
Having the right equipment is only half the battle. Proper technique is paramount. Our experience shows that a standardized, aseptic procedure is the only way to guarantee safety and data integrity. Let's walk through it.
-
Assemble Your Station: Before you even touch a vial, get everything you need in one clean space. This includes your vial of Glutathione, a vial of Bacteriostatic Reconstitution Water (bac), alcohol prep pads, your chosen Glutathione needles syringes, and a certified sharps container. Working in a clean, organized manner prevents costly mistakes.
-
Prepare the Vials: Remove the plastic caps from the vials. Vigorously scrub the rubber stoppers on both vials with an alcohol pad and let them air dry completely. Do not blow on them or wipe them dry. This is a critical sterilization step.
-
Reconstitute the Peptide: This is where precision begins. Using a syringe, draw the exact amount of bacteriostatic water specified in your protocol. Insert the needle into the Glutathione vial, angling it so the water runs down the side of the glass, not directly onto the lyophilized powder. This prevents damaging the delicate peptide structure. Do not shake the vial. Ever. Gently swirl or roll it between your hands until the powder is fully dissolved. The solution should be crystal clear.
-
Draw the Dose: Uncap a new, sterile syringe for administration. Insert the needle into the reconstituted Glutathione vial. Invert the vial and pull the plunger back slowly to draw slightly more than your required dose. This helps you manage any small air bubbles. Tap the syringe barrel to make the bubbles rise to the top, then gently push the plunger to expel the air and adjust the dose to the precise measurement line. Having the right Glutathione needles syringes with clear markings makes this step far less stressful.
-
Prepare the Administration Site: Select a subcutaneous injection site, such as the abdomen or thigh. Clean the area thoroughly with a new alcohol pad in a circular motion and allow it to air dry.
-
Administer the Dose: Gently pinch a fold of skin. Depending on the needle length and amount of fatty tissue, insert the needle at a 45- or 90-degree angle. Depress the plunger steadily until the syringe is empty. Wait a moment before withdrawing the needle to prevent any solution from leaking out. Withdraw the needle smoothly and apply gentle pressure with a sterile gauze if needed.
-
Immediate and Safe Disposal: This is non-negotiable. Immediately place the used Glutathione needles syringes into a designated sharps container. Do not recap the needle—this is a primary cause of accidental needlesticks. A full sharps container should be disposed of according to local biomedical waste regulations.

Common Pitfalls and How to Avoid Them in 2026
We've seen it all. Even the most experienced researchers can fall into bad habits. Here are some of the most common—and dangerous—mistakes we see with the use of Glutathione needles syringes, and how to steer clear of them.
-
The Cardinal Sin: Reusing Needles. Never, ever reuse a needle, not even on the same test subject. A needle is microscopically blunted after a single use. Reusing it causes more pain, tissue damage, and dramatically increases the risk of infection. Needles are single-use disposables. Period. This is a fundamental rule for anyone using Glutathione needles syringes.
-
Botching Reconstitution. Adding the wrong amount of diluent will throw off your entire dosing calculation. Shaking the vial can denature the peptide, rendering it ineffective. Always be gentle, be precise, and follow your protocol to the letter.
-
Measurement Myopia. Misreading the lines on a syringe is an easy mistake to make, especially with small doses. This is why we recommend insulin syringes; their markings are designed for this very purpose. Always double-check your dose before administration. Hold the syringe at eye level to get an accurate reading. When it comes to Glutathione needles syringes, a small slip of the eye can be a huge error in dosage.
-
Improper Storage. Once reconstituted, Glutathione must be stored correctly, typically refrigerated, to maintain its stability and potency. Leaving it at room temperature for extended periods will degrade the peptide. Always check the storage requirements for your specific product.
